Why Cairo, and why Egypt matters to everyone else

Egypt is the chokepoint of the global internet: the great majority of cable capacity between Europe and Asia crosses the country overland between the Red Sea and the Mediterranean, because the alternative is going around Africa. That makes Egypt's national operator one of the most important transit carriers in the world and puts Cairo within roughly 30 to 45 ms of Athens, 40 to 60 of Jeddah and 55 to 75 of Frankfurt. Cairo is where the domestic networks meet and where nearly all Egyptian users are close to.

What Egypt blocks and what it keeps

Since 2017 the authorities have blocked several hundred websites, including most independent news outlets and the sites of many VPN providers, and the 2018 Anti-Cybercrime Law gave that a legal basis. The same law requires providers to retain user data for 180 days and to make it available to security services. A personal data protection law passed in 2020, though its implementing regulations were slow to arrive. Using a VPN is not itself an offence; accessing blocked content through one is a grey area the law does not clearly address, and prosecutions have focused on what people publish.

What this changes about your connection

With the tunnel up, your provider sees encrypted traffic to one VPNmine address in Cairo, so what it retains under the 2018 law is a connection to that address rather than the sites behind it, and it cannot apply the blocklist to what it cannot see. Sites see the Cairo server. That is a description of how network-level filtering works, not advice to break Egyptian law. VPNmine's own servers are not on the published blocklists; whether a connection from an Egyptian network passes on a given day is something no provider can honestly guarantee.

Confirm it rather than assume it

Connect to Cairo, then check what changed. Our IP checker shows the address and country sites now see. The DNS leak test shows whether your domain lookups are still going to your own provider, which is the most common way a tunnel protects less than it appears to. The WebRTC leak test catches the browser handing out your real address through an API the VPN never sees.

Why is Egypt so central to internet routing?

Because the cables between Europe and Asia run through the Red Sea and the Suez corridor, crossing Egypt overland between the two seas. The alternative is to go around Africa, so most do not, and Egypt's national operator carries a large share of the traffic between the two continents. It is also why a fault in the Red Sea slows down connections far from Egypt.
